[GIT PULL] OMAP-GPMC related cleanup for common zImage
Afzal Mohammed
afzal at ti.com
Mon Oct 15 08:33:36 EDT 2012
The following changes since commit ddffeb8c4d0331609ef2581d84de4d763607bd37:
Linux 3.7-rc1 (2012-10-14 14:41:04 -0700)
are available in the git repository at:
git://gitorious.org/x0148406-public/linux-kernel.git tags/gpmc-czimage
for you to fetch changes up to 3ef5d0071cf6c8b9a00b559232bb700ad59999d7:
ARM: OMAP2+: gpmc: localize gpmc header (2012-10-15 14:42:15 +0530)
----------------------------------------------------------------
gpmc cleanup for common ARM zImage
----------------------------------------------------------------
Afzal Mohammed (16):
ARM: OMAP2+: nand: unify init functions
ARM: OMAP2+: onenand: refactor for clarity
ARM: OMAP2+: gpmc: remove cs# in sync clk div calc
mtd: onenand: omap: cleanup gpmc dependency
mtd: nand: omap: free region as per resource size
mtd: nand: omap: read nand using register address
ARM: OMAP2+: onenand: connected soc info in pdata
mtd: onenand: omap: use pdata info instead of cpu_is
ARM: OMAP2+: onenand: header cleanup
ARM: OMAP2+: nand: header cleanup
mtd: nand: omap: bring in gpmc nand macros
ARM: OMAP2+: nand: bch capability check
ARM: OMAP2+: gpmc: nand register helper bch update
mtd: nand: omap: handle gpmc bch[48]
ARM: OMAP2+: gpmc: remove exported nand functions
ARM: OMAP2+: gpmc: localize gpmc header
Jon Hunter (1):
ARM: OMAP2+: GPMC: Remove unused OneNAND get_freq() platform function
arch/arm/mach-omap2/board-2430sdp.c | 2 +-
arch/arm/mach-omap2/board-3430sdp.c | 2 +-
arch/arm/mach-omap2/board-apollon.c | 2 +-
arch/arm/mach-omap2/board-cm-t35.c | 5 +-
arch/arm/mach-omap2/board-cm-t3517.c | 5 +-
arch/arm/mach-omap2/board-devkit8000.c | 10 +-
arch/arm/mach-omap2/board-flash.c | 50 +--
arch/arm/mach-omap2/board-flash.h | 8 +-
arch/arm/mach-omap2/board-h4.c | 2 +-
arch/arm/mach-omap2/board-igep0020.c | 5 +-
arch/arm/mach-omap2/board-ldp.c | 6 +-
arch/arm/mach-omap2/board-n8x0.c | 1 +
arch/arm/mach-omap2/board-omap3beagle.c | 10 +-
arch/arm/mach-omap2/board-omap3evm.c | 8 +-
arch/arm/mach-omap2/board-omap3logic.c | 2 +-
arch/arm/mach-omap2/board-omap3pandora.c | 3 +-
arch/arm/mach-omap2/board-omap3stalker.c | 2 +-
arch/arm/mach-omap2/board-omap3touchbook.c | 10 +-
arch/arm/mach-omap2/board-overo.c | 9 +-
arch/arm/mach-omap2/board-rm680.c | 3 +-
arch/arm/mach-omap2/board-rx51-peripherals.c | 3 +-
arch/arm/mach-omap2/board-rx51.c | 2 +-
arch/arm/mach-omap2/board-zoom-debugboard.c | 2 +-
arch/arm/mach-omap2/board-zoom.c | 5 +-
arch/arm/mach-omap2/common-board-devices.c | 46 ---
arch/arm/mach-omap2/common-board-devices.h | 1 -
arch/arm/mach-omap2/gpmc-nand.c | 85 ++--
arch/arm/mach-omap2/gpmc-nand.h | 27 ++
arch/arm/mach-omap2/gpmc-onenand.c | 214 +++++-----
arch/arm/mach-omap2/gpmc-onenand.h | 24 ++
arch/arm/mach-omap2/gpmc-smc91x.c | 2 +-
arch/arm/mach-omap2/gpmc-smsc911x.c | 2 +-
arch/arm/mach-omap2/gpmc.c | 459 +--------------------
.../{plat-omap/include/plat => mach-omap2}/gpmc.h | 61 +--
arch/arm/mach-omap2/pm34xx.c | 2 +-
arch/arm/mach-omap2/usb-tusb6010.c | 2 +-
drivers/mtd/nand/omap2.c | 125 +++++-
drivers/mtd/onenand/omap2.c | 9 +-
include/linux/platform_data/mtd-nand-omap2.h | 46 ++-
include/linux/platform_data/mtd-onenand-omap2.h | 28 +-
40 files changed, 493 insertions(+), 797 deletions(-)
create mode 100644 arch/arm/mach-omap2/gpmc-nand.h
create mode 100644 arch/arm/mach-omap2/gpmc-onenand.h
rename arch/arm/{plat-omap/include/plat => mach-omap2}/gpmc.h (67%)
More information about the linux-arm-kernel
mailing list